JUST IN: Many feared dead as hoodlums enforce sit-at-home in Enugu

Five persons are feared dead on Saturday morning following attack by hoodlums enforcing Simon Ekpa’s five days sit-at-home order in the South East.
A viral video circulating online has showed yet to be identified two victims lying lifeless at the front of Enugu State University Teaching Hospital, Parklane.
Others were shot at the New Market Area. A police car was also set ablaze within the same location.
Eyewitness recounted that the gunmen, numbering over ten, stormed the area as early as 6 a.m. before shooting into the air to scare people off the street.
They are marching from one part of the State to another without resistance.
Following the development, many residents have been forced indoors for fear of attack
